WebIn the late 17th century, a game called Hyakumonogatari Kaidankai became popular, and kaidan increasingly became a subject for theater, literature and other arts. Ukiyo-e artist Maruyama Ōkyo created the first known example of the now-traditional yūrei, in his painting The Ghost of Oyuki. Web11 apr. 2024 · Maruyama Okyo’s ink painting The Ghost of Oyuki (1750) shows the artist’s lover, who died young, as an ethereal, floating being wrapped in a white dress and topped with a head of wild, deep-black hair. His rendering would set an aesthetic precedent for all artistic interpretations of yūrei to come. bryn thorne vs joey ryan

Web28 oct. 2009 · Japanese Ghosts Posted by Ginny on Oct 28, 2009 in Culture. Generally speaking ゆうれい means ‘ghost’ in Japanese. However, there is a slightly negative connotation with the word ゆうれい. The word ゆうれい could imply a number of things such as: the ghost had died violently or suddenly, the ghost has some kind of grudge or ... Web27 aug. 2024 · In traditional Japanese folklore, yurei are typically depicted as women with stringy black hair and white kimonos. Often, they have no legs and float slightly above the ground.
